 | | BLIDA, a town of Algeria, in the department of Algiers, 3 2 m. |
 | | Blida is surrounded by a wall of considerable extent, pierced by six gates, and is further defended by Fort Mimieh, crowning a steep hill on the left bank of the river. |
 | | Blida is the chief town of a commune of the same name, having (1906) a population of 33,332. |
